| Property Content | Property Values |
|---|---|
| SiO2 | 99.99% |
| Density | 2.2×10³ kg/cm³ |
| Hardness | 5.5 - 6.5 Mohs' Scale 570 KHN 100 |
| Tensile Strength | 4.8×10⁷ Pa (N/mm2) (7000 psi) |
| Compression Strength | >1.1×10⁹ Pa (160,000 psi) |
| Coefficient of Thermal Expansion | 5.5×10⁻⁷ cm/cm·°C (20°C-320°C) |
| Thermal Conductivity | 1.4 W/m·°C |
| Specific Heat | 670 J/kg·°C |
| Softening Point | 1730°C (3146°F) |
| Annealing Point | 1210°C (2210°F) |
| Strain Point | 1120°C (2048°F) |
| Work Temperature | 1200°C (2192°F) |
| Electrical Resistivity | 7×10⁷ ohm cm (350°C) |

Exceptional High-Temperature Resistance
Engineered from high-purity quartz, these combustion tubes can withstand continuous operation at extreme temperatures (typically up to 1100-1200°C), making them indispensable for high-temperature combustion, ashing, and elemental analysis furnaces.
Unmatched Purity & Contamination-Free Analysis
The ultra-high purity of fused silica (SiO2 ≥ 99.99%) ensures that the tube itself does not introduce any impurities or react with samples, guaranteeing accurate and reliable results, particularly for sensitive carbon, sulfur, and nitrogen elemental analysis.
Superior Chemical Inertness & Durability
Quartz is highly resistant to most acids, alkalis, and reactive gases, preventing corrosion and degradation even when processing samples that produce aggressive combustion byproducts. This chemical stability contributes to a longer service life and consistent performance.
Precision & Customization for Specific Instruments
Available in a wide range of standard and custom dimensions (diameters, lengths, and end configurations), these tubes can be precisely tailored to fit various elemental analyzers and combustion furnaces, ensuring optimal performance and compatibility with specific analytical setups.
Application Scenario
Elemental Analysis (C, S, N, O, H)
Crucial components in elemental analyzers for carbon, sulfur, nitrogen, oxygen, and hydrogen determination. These tubes provide the high-temperature and contamination-free environment necessary for complete combustion of samples and accurate measurement of liberated gases.
High-Temperature Material Testing & Ashing
Utilized in laboratories for high-temperature material characterization, such as ashing, calcination, or gravimetric analysis. They provide an inert and stable chamber for heating samples to extreme temperatures without reacting with the material or introducing impurities.
Combustion Furnaces & Process Heating
Employed as reaction vessels or liners within high-temperature combustion furnaces in various industrial processes. Their exceptional heat resistance and chemical inertness make them ideal for processes requiring elevated temperatures and a controlled, non-contaminating environment.
Gas Purification & Reaction Systems
Used as reaction tubes in gas purification setups or specialized chemical reaction systems where gases need to be heated to high temperatures in an inert, high-purity environment. This ensures efficient reactions and prevents side reactions or contamination from the tube material.

The lifespan of a quartz combustion tube can vary significantly depending on the operating temperature, sample matrix, frequency of use, and cleaning protocols. While quartz offers excellent durability and heat resistance, constant exposure to extreme temperatures and certain corrosive combustion byproducts can eventually lead to devitrification or embrittlement. Proper cleaning and careful handling can maximize their service life.
For optimal performance and longevity, quartz combustion tubes should be regularly cleaned to remove residues. Depending on the type of residue, this might involve soaking in appropriate acid baths (avoiding hydrofluoric acid), heating to burn off organic residues, or mechanical cleaning with specialized brushes. Always follow your instrument manufacturer’s cleaning recommendations and ensure thorough drying before reuse to maintain the tube’s high purity and prevent contamination.
